Why an eSIM Is the Easiest Way to Get Online in Turkey

Turkey stretches from the historic bridge between continents in Istanbul to the beach resorts of Antalya, Bodrum, and Alanya along the Turquoise Coast. Covering that much ground makes staying connected a priority, and an eSIM gets you online the moment you land, wherever your trip starts.
Here's what makes it worth setting up in advance:
- Activate before departure — configure your plan at home and arrive with data already working
- Skip the airport SIM counters — no queues or paperwork needed at Istanbul, Antalya, or Bodrum airports
- Keep your home number reachable — stay available on your usual line while the eSIM handles data
- Built for multi-city trips — ideal if your itinerary spans Istanbul and the southern coastal resorts
With domestic flights and long coastal drives often part of a Turkey trip, having data ready from arrival keeps every leg simple.
Istanbul: Coverage Across Two Continents

Istanbul's network coverage is strong and consistent on both sides of the Bosphorus, with reliable 4G and expanding 5G throughout the city. You'll find dependable signal around:
- Sultanahmet, home to the Hagia Sophia, Blue Mosque, and Topkapi Palace
- Taksim and Istiklal Street, the modern shopping and nightlife district
- The Bosphorus waterfront, popular for ferry rides between the European and Asian sides

Antalya: Staying Connected on the Turquoise Coast

Antalya's coverage is equally dependable, extending from its old town to its beach resorts. Expect solid signal around:
- Kaleici, the old town of narrow lanes, Ottoman houses, and the historic harbor
- Konyaalti and Lara beaches, the city's main stretches of coastline
- Duden Waterfalls and surrounding parks, popular day-trip destinations
A reliable connection makes it easy to book boat tours along the coast or navigate Kaleici's winding streets.
Bodrum and Alanya: Connectivity Along the Coast

Both resort towns offer solid coverage across their main areas, each with their own character:
- Bodrum Castle and the marina in Bodrum, known for its whitewashed buildings and yacht harbor
- Alanya Castle and Cleopatra Beach in Alanya, a hilltop fortress overlooking the sea
- Coastal resort strips, where hotels and beach clubs maintain dependable signal
Coverage can thin out slightly on remote coastal roads between towns, so it's worth downloading offline maps for longer drives.
Practical Tips for Using Your eSIM Across Turkey

A few habits will help your connection hold up as you move between cities and coastal towns:
- Download offline maps for coastal drives or day trips into rural areas, where signal can be less consistent
- Monitor your data usage through your provider's app, especially useful given the distances between Istanbul and the southern coast
- Use hotel or resort Wi-Fi in the evenings to conserve mobile data for daytime sightseeing
- Keep your eSIM active as you move between Istanbul, Antalya, Bodrum, and Alanya
